Analysis

In 2024, paper and paperboard — export quantity in World stood at 111.57 million t.

The figure is up 7.3% on the previous year and down 0.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, paper and paperboard — export quantity in World peaked at 118.43 million t in 2007 and was at its lowest, 12.69 million t, in 1961.

That places World 1st out of 33 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the top 10%.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 16.60 million t 12.69 million t 22.33 million t 9
1970s 27.09 million t 22.98 million t 33.13 million t 10
1980s 41.36 million t 33.50 million t 52.25 million t 10
1990s 73.39 million t 55.62 million t 93.20 million t 10
2000s 106.69 million t 93.43 million t 118.43 million t 10
2010s 112.41 million t 108.13 million t 117.27 million t 10
2020s 111.22 million t 103.98 million t 116.04 million t 5

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
